My Buying Guides on Light For Crystal Display

Why I Care About the Right Light

When I choose a light for a crystal display, I look for more than brightness. I want the crystals to sparkle, the colors to stay true, and the display to feel elegant rather than harsh. The right light can make a crystal piece look ordinary or absolutely stunning, so I always treat lighting as part of the display itself.

What I Look For First

The first thing I check is the type of light. I usually prefer LED lights because they stay cool, use less energy, and are gentle on delicate items. I also pay attention to brightness, beam angle, and color temperature. A warm white light can create a soft, luxurious look, while a cool white light often makes crystal edges and reflections stand out more sharply.

Brightness Matters More Than I Expected

I learned that too much brightness can wash out the beauty of crystal, while too little makes it disappear in the background. I usually look for adjustable brightness so I can control the effect depending on the room and the size of the display. Dimmable lights give me the flexibility I need.

Why Color Temperature Changes the Look

In my experience, color temperature makes a huge difference. If I want a classic, cozy presentation, I go with warmer tones. If I want the crystal to look crisp and modern, I choose cooler white light. For colored crystal pieces, I test the lighting first because certain tones can either enhance or dull the color.

Placement Is Just as Important as the Light Itself

I always think about where the light will sit. Top lighting gives a dramatic shine, while side lighting can reveal texture and cut details. I also like hidden or accent lighting behind shelves because it makes the crystal glow without showing the source directly. Poor placement can create glare, so I try to angle the light carefully.

Safety and Heat Are Important to Me

Crystal may be durable, but I still avoid lights that produce too much heat. I prefer cool-running options because they are safer for long-term use and help protect surrounding materials. If the display is enclosed, I make sure the light will not trap heat inside.

Style and Design of the Fixture

I want the light fixture to complement the display, not distract from it. Slim, discreet lights usually work best for me because they keep the focus on the crystal. If the fixture is visible, I choose one with a clean finish that matches the room’s decor.
